Phendimetrazine is known as anorectigenic drug. It is a symphatomimetic amine that stimulates central nervous system and decreases appetite. This drug can have serious side effects and cause disturbances like blurred vision, dizziness, insomnia… I mean, these effects are not that serious, but it seems to me like are serious for 18 years old girl. Anyway, this medication should be used along with exercising and diet, so it would be much healthier to try again without taking phendimetrazine. Phendimetrazine is also habit forming drug.
